This
page attempts to record what is known about the origin
and history of the origami design known as the Trough.

Thank you. ********** 1918 A design called 'Artesa' (Trough) that is probably The Trough appears in 'Ciencia Recreativa' by Jose Estralella, which was published by Gustavo Gili in Barcelona in 1918. No illustration of the finished figure is provided. ********** 1939 As far as I am aware this variant of the Pig design first appears, as 'La artesa' in 'El Mundo de Papel' by Dr Nemesio Montero, which was published by G Miranda in Edicions Infancia in Valladolid in 1939. ********** 1964 The Trough also appears in 'Secrets of Origami', by Robert Harbin, which was published by Oldbourne Book Company in London in 1964, as a 'Crib' for the baby Jesus as part of Ligia Montoya's creche sequence. ********** |
